Is Cedar Point South Safe?

Yes — this neighborhood is extremely safe. Cedar Point South in Boynton Beach, FL has a safety grade of A+. The overall crime index is 62, which is 38% below the national average of 100.

Compared to the Boynton Beach average (crime index 119), Cedar Point South is 57% lower in overall crime. This neighborhood is significantly safer than Boynton Beach as a whole, making it an attractive option for safety-conscious residents.

Looking at specific crime types, assault is the most elevated concern (index: 169, 69% above average), while rape is the lowest risk (index: 4).
